Serbia, Kingdom. An Order Of The White Eagle, Iv Class, By Karl Fleischhacker, C. 1900 Buy Now the reverse with a standard(Orden Belog Orla). Instituted in 1883. Type I (1882 1903). In silver, a lovely white enamelled double headed eagle, the center medallion featuring a white enamelled cross, the reverse medallion presents the crowned cypher of Milan I MI on a red enamelled field, the eagle is secured to a large surmounting crown by two blue enamelled pendilia inscribed 22 1882 on the reverse, measures 35. 30mm (w) x 74. 85mm (h), weighs 38. 5 grams, marked on ring KF
